This Creepy Brooklyn Super Wears a Body Cam

And you thought your super was weird.

This should put your super problems into perspective! Last Friday, Gothamist ran an extensive profile on Herchin Ablai, the by-all-accounts authoritarian, kinda racist and totally creepy super who has exacted a decade-long ”reign of terror” over the brick apartment building at 60 Turner Place in Ditmas Park, Brooklyn.

The kicker: Dude wears a body cam.

“You can’t go outside without him standing there like a police officer, staring at you,” George O’Connor, an 83-year-old building resident, told Gothamist.

“With the camera, it’s quiet now in the building,” Ablai told Gothamist.

The nightmare super has reportedly banned everything from jubilant noise-making to neighborly congregating to sunflower planting, and has turned 60 Turner into a dark and paranoid place where residents say they walk on ”pins and needles” and require medical treatment for super-related stress disease.
